Quote:
Originally Posted by vincE92M3 View Post
Thanks for the insight!

I've been working on improving the connected feel of this car since I got it. To me, the shifter and clutch feel not match the rest of the car.

I did get the M5 knob, UCP (stiffest setting), and have changed to Redline MTL, which both have helped tremendously.

I'm still debating if it is worth trying an SSK with the M3...
+1 for the AutoSolutions kit, it makes an enormous difference. The stock shifter feels like stirring a bowl of mashed potatoes while the AS shifter feels like a bolt action rifle. Seriously, you need it!

Quote:
Originally Posted by vincE92M3 View Post
Thanks for the info! What spec did you have your SSK built to?
I basically told Ronald to build it to whatever spec he would build for himself. It came out to ~18% throw reduction and +6mm height to account for my 12mm shorter F10 shift knob.
